The primary purpose of this bodyshop is to return your BMW or Mini to its precise factory specification. Unlike generic repair centers, Sytner Hitchin uses only genuine OEM parts and adheres strictly to the complex repair procedures set by the manufacturers. This isn't just about aesthetics; it's about preserving the vehicle's structural integrity, safety systems, and long-term value. For example, repairing a modern BMW's bumper isn't just about painting it—it involves recalibrating parking sensors and radar units, a task that requires specialized diagnostic equipment found only at an approved center like this one.

Another common scenario involves the increasingly complex paint technology used on modern vehicles. A metallic or pearlescent finish is notoriously difficult to replicate. The technicians at Sytner Hitchin use computerized paint-mixing systems and bake ovens to cure the paint at the correct temperature, ensuring durability and a perfect blend. This attention to detail means that a repaired door or wing will not fade or peel differently from the rest of the car, protecting your investment and your car’s resale value for years to come.

For those looking to explore this resource, here are a few simple tips. First, if you are involved in an accident, always ask your insurance provider if you can choose your own repairer; you have the legal right to request Sytner Hitchin. Second, schedule a free digital estimate for any damage—even a small chip—before it exposes the metal to rust. Third, request a courtesy vehicle at the time of booking to avoid any interruption to your plans. Finally, keep all the repair paperwork; a full Sytner repair history is a powerful selling point and a mark of quality for future buyers.
